The Farrell Report: Maryland Million Day, Baffert Horses OKd for Breeders CupOctober 19, 2021 (16:15) [ Indexed from Daily Racing News ] By Mike Farrell Jim McKay, the legendary host of ABCs Wide World of Sports and a lover of thoroughbred racing, returned from the inaugural Breeders Cup in 1984 with a thought that would not let him rest. Why couldnt his beloved Maryland racing industry stage its own equivalent of the Breeders Cup for horses bred in the state? From McKays vision and dedication sprang a new series in 1986"Maryland Million Day. That great tradition continues Saturday at Laurel Park with a 12-race card topped by the $150,000 Classic. The Lineup: Champions Saturday at AscotOctober 15, 2021 (21:45) [ Indexed from Daily Racing News ] By Richard Rosenblatt And now, a slight TV upgrade for your horse racing viewing pleasure: FOX Sports will have live coverage of British Champions Day from Ascot Racecourse in England on Saturday. The New York Racing Association has partnered with FOX, and Englands richest day of racing will air on FS2 from 8-11:30 a.m. (ET). Americas Day at the Races will feature live racing from Belmont Park, from 12:30-3:30 p.m., on FS2. TVG will have its usual live coverage of races from tracks around the country.
